Ultimate Moving Day Checklist UK: Complete Step-by-Step Guide

Moving house in the UK is widely regarded as one of life’s most stressful experiences. However, with structured preparation, professional planning and a clear timeline, your relocation can be efficient and controlled. This comprehensive moving day checklist has been created specifically for UK home movers and covers everything you need to organise before, during and after your house move.

Why a Structured Moving Checklist Matters

Many moving day issues arise from rushed decisions and overlooked tasks. Forgotten meter readings, unlabelled boxes and poor planning can lead to unnecessary stress and additional expense. A clear checklist ensures your move remains organised and predictable.

Four Weeks Before Moving

  • Book a reputable removal company early, particularly during peak summer months.
  • Declutter unwanted items to reduce removal volume and costs.
  • Order high-quality packing materials including double-walled boxes and protective wrap.
  • Notify your landlord if renting.
  • Research local amenities in your new area.

Two Weeks Before Moving

  • Begin packing non-essential belongings.
  • Clearly label each box with room destination and brief contents.
  • Arrange Royal Mail redirection.
  • Notify DVLA, banks, insurers and utility suppliers.
  • Confirm broadband installation dates.

One Week Before Moving

  • Confirm arrival time and parking arrangements with your removals team.
  • Prepare a “first night” essentials box.
  • Defrost fridge and freezer 24 hours prior.
  • Disassemble large furniture if required.
  • Take meter readings at your current property.

On Moving Day

  • Conduct a final inspection of cupboards, loft and garage.
  • Allow professionals to load heavy items first for stability.
  • Inspect your new property before unloading begins.
  • Direct boxes to correct rooms.

After Moving In

  • Register with local GP and council.
  • Update remaining address records.
  • Check insurance coverage at your new address.

With structured preparation and professional assistance where required, your house move can be efficient and far less stressful.
